I myself am interested for this reason (and apologies for repeating something I wrote a few years ago): in any communal activity, from roommates sharing a house to corporations manufacturing and selling a product, you behave according to the precepts of a moral pyramid. (My econ teacher put this on the board in 8th grade -- sparing you an attempt to actually draw a pyramid, imagine these four bases for decisions as if they're in a pyramid shape:

 

MORAL

 

LEGAL

 

ACCEPTED PRACTICE

 

THE LAW OF THE JUNGLE

 

I'm sure there's more information on the net about how that works, but my teacher's point 35 years ago was that obviously the best, most helpful way to make decisions was if they had a moral basis, and if not that then a legal, and if not that...

 

His point was also that more people followed the law of the jungle and fewer the moral path.

 

Funny, given wikileaks and whatnot, but I've noticed that regardless of the net and the price databases, there is sometimes less and less transparency as time goes on, not more.

 

I have no idea what's going on with this splash's ownership or pricing, but as the money behind the hobby solidifies, I think an inquiry into where on the moral pyramid a given transaction falls is -- as long as it's factual -- at least interesting if not also an inquiry to how things work around here.

What's the estimated value of X-Men #1 pages, as I know when the book was broken up and auctioned on Heritage, I posted a thread here back in 2008, about 7 years ago when they were selling for I believe $15,000 to $25,000 +/- per page. But, also back then certain Kirby pages were about 1/3 the value they're commanding today.

 

Do you think an avg page from X-Men #1 goes for $50k and an extraordinary page may hit $75k, with the best pages (all characters in costume vs magneto) hitting $100k + ?

 

I know a lot of collectors downplay the art for the rendering and inking despite it being a #1 and 1st Appearance issue, so, even 'tho the Fantastic Four are less popular, any page from FF #1 would probably if not definately outshine and out perform an X-Men #1 page in today's world where nobody cares about the FF and the X-Men are still popular and have been more popular than the FF in the past 30 years.
